Apoorva Sahodarulu (transl. Unique Brothers) is a 1986 Indian Telugu-language action film, produced by K. Krishna Mohana Rao under the R. K. Associates banner and directed by K. Raghavendra Rao. It stars Nandamuri Balakrishna, Vijayashanti, Bhanupriya and music was composed by Chakravarthy. This is the first time Nandamuri Balakrishna plays a dual role.[2][3]

Music composed by Chakravarthy. Lyrics written by Veturi Sundararama Murthy. Music released on AVM Audio Company.

S.No Song Title Singers length
1 "My Dear Rambha" SP Balu, S. Janaki, P. Susheela 5:09
2 "Swapna Priya Swapna" SP Balu, S. Janaki 5:42
3 "Dongava Dochuko" SP Balu,P. Susheela 4:29
4 "Appalamma Aadite" SP Balu, S. Janaki 4:56
5 "Piduganti Pillodu" SP Balu, P. Susheela 4:30
